Curse of the Mummy's Tomb
M. T. Acquaire
A Marty Boggs Paranormal Mystery
Publisher: CreateSpace
Marty's grandfather always said that superstition was nothing more than nonsense that hindered fools from discovery, but now Marty's not so sure. Ever since his grandfather, a world-renowned archeologist, discovered a tomb in Egypt his family has been plagued with tragedy.
First Marty's mother disappears, and then Reginald himself collapses at the museum in the weeks leading up to the mummy's unveiling. One by one children start to disappear as the town turns against Marty and his family, blaming them for unleashing the curse upon them.
Haunted by visions of creatures that shouldn't exist, Marty soon finds himself in a waking nightmare filled with demons running rampant in the streets, ghouls masquerading in the flesh of humans, and an evil necromancer who will stop at nothing to secure his own immortality.
As if that wasn't enough, then there's Daniel Richardson, the most beautiful girl Marty has ever laid eyes on. The only thing is, his competition isn't another boy at school, it's the monster behind the abductions, and now he has to find a way to stop her from being taken next.
